tried martelli- wasnt crazy about it, im lefty, and the blade was wobbly, ill stick to my plain old straight olfa. And buy my blades 2@$1.99 at harbor freight, they are carpet cutting blades, they do the same job as the olfa n fiskars, but one can afford them at $1.00 each to throw them away!

I love my Olfa that closes automatically when I let go of the handle. I have three other makes, but they all require me to physically put on the safety catch. The Olfa is the safest in my opinion.
